Why More Buyers Are Choosing Suburbs Outside Charlotte in 2026

The Charlotte area continues to grow, but in 2026 many home buyers are looking beyond the city limits for one simple reason:

They can often get more for their money.

As home prices, traffic, and monthly costs remain top concerns, buyers are expanding their searches to surrounding towns like Concord, Harrisburg, Kannapolis, Midland, Mount Pleasant, and other nearby communities.

For many families, first-time buyers, and move-up buyers, these areas offer the balance they’ve been looking for.

Affordability Still Matters

Charlotte remains one of the most desirable cities in the Southeast, but higher home prices have pushed many buyers to explore nearby markets.

In surrounding towns, buyers may find:

  • More square footage

  • Larger lots or yards

  • Newer homes at similar price points

  • Lower monthly housing costs in some cases

For buyers trying to maximize budget, moving a little farther out can make a big difference.

More Space and Better Lifestyle Fit

Today’s buyers are thinking long-term. They want homes that fit their current needs and future plans.

That often means looking for:

  • Home offices

  • Extra bedrooms

  • Outdoor space

  • Garages and storage

  • Family-friendly neighborhoods

Suburban communities outside Charlotte often provide these features at a more accessible price point.

Remote and Hybrid Work Changed Priorities

Many buyers no longer need to be in the city every day. With hybrid work schedules becoming more common, commute distance is less of a deciding factor than it once was.

That has opened the door for buyers to prioritize space, comfort, and affordability over living close to Uptown Charlotte.

Popular Areas Buyers Are Watching

Some of the most searched and fastest-growing areas near Charlotte include:

  • Concord – Great shopping, growth, and commuter access

  • Harrisburg – Popular for schools and community feel

  • Kannapolis – Revitalization and value opportunities

  • Midland & Mount Pleasant – More land and quieter lifestyle

  • Mooresville – Lake lifestyle and strong amenities

Each area offers something different depending on budget and lifestyle goals.
